This will take you to a blank map where you can start adding markers, polylines, and other shapes to create your custom map.

Start by dragging a marker onto the map to add it as a point of interest. You can then use the toolbar at the top right corner of the screen to draw lines, circles, or polygons around the marker. Use the zoom function to expand or contract the view and see your map come alive.

One of the best things about Google My Maps is its ability to integrate with other Google services like Google Sheets and Google Forms. You can create custom shapes that update in real-time when you make changes to a spreadsheet, for example, or add custom fields to forms to collect data from users.

To take your map to the next level, consider adding custom images, videos, or other media to make it more engaging and interactive. You can also use Google My Maps' built-in features like labels and annotations to highlight important information on your map.
